Ok, so I have my Henglong Challenger. Runs like a dream.

I would like to up grade a wee bit.

As part of this I intend to install bearing seals and bearings.

To do this I need to take off the drive wheels.

BUT...

Having got the tank up and running following the instructions I had put the wheel hubs on the wheels.

So the question is

How do I remove the hubs from the drive wheels?

Much thanks in advance. Peter.

Try borrowing your wife/girlfriend/mum's Marigolds to get better grip and then try to twist the caps out a little. Once you have the slightest gap you can gently prise the caps off with a scalpel blade. Its worked for me in the past.

Get a cheap set of jewelers screwdrivers and try to pry the edges. Bear in mind if you bruise the edge of the cap, it can be filed or otherwise dressed to get it looking good as new.
dont be scared to use a bit of mongrel on it, the object is not the cap, but what lies beneath it that matters, the cap could be acceptable collateral damage in the grander strategy to get those sprockets off !!!
